Signs and symptoms of bad 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 brake rotors

It's extraordinarily exciting that you take your 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 into an auto repair shop if you experience any of the following warning signs of failing or degrading rotors.

  • Vibrations in the brake pedal when applying pressure. This is a sign that your 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 brake rotors may be warped or highly worn down.
  • Visible score marks on the rotors are a sign that repeated contact has excessively worn down the rotors on your 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450.
  • Odd noise or extraordinarily high pitched screeching sounds coming from outer the vehicle when your brakes are applied.
  • If you notice poor brake responsiveness or increasingly longer stopping distances when applying your brakes then your vehicle needs to be brought in for inspection quickly.
How long do 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 brake rotors last?

The explanation depends heavily on the type of rotors, the conditions of your everyday commute, your driving style, and the type of vehicle you're driving. Constantly, 2018 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 rotors need to be replaced every 30,000 - 80,000 miles depending on the characteristics above. It is always best to reference your Mercedes-Benz GLS 450 maintenance manual for more information.
